Multiple passes is the key.

I use Mitchell's as well. Great Soap.

I soak my brush in hot water, shake it out and rub it on the top of the puck for about 10 seconds to load the brush. I face lather, so I just rub the soapy brush on my face.

Then shave going with the grain.

Splash hot water, later, shave across the grain.

After you get the hang of it, do a third pass going against the grain. I can only go against the grain on part of my face, otherwise I get ingrown hairs.

Good luck, take it slow and get an styptic pencil. First week might be rough. Don't use the Feather or Kai first. They are sharper. I think I used Derby first. I only use Feather now. I think the Merkur were really bad. I get about 4-5 days with a blade. I try to push it for 6 (full week, I don't shave on Sat), but I can tell.
